Do you clean leather seats?
Yes — leather seat cleaning and conditioning is included in our interior detail services. Louisiana's heat and humidity are particularly hard on leather, causing it to dry, crack, and fade faster than in cooler climates, so regular conditioning is one of the best things you can do for your vehicle's interior in Ponchatoula.
Do you shampoo cloth seats and carpets?
Yes — cloth seat shampooing and carpet extraction are core parts of our interior detail. We use hot-water extraction to lift dirt, odors, and stains from deep within the fibers, which is essential for keeping vehicle interiors fresh in Ponchatoula's humid, mold-friendly climate.
Do you clean exterior wheels and tires?
Yes — wheels and tires are included in our exterior detail service. We degrease and scrub brake dust and road grime from wheels and apply a tire dressing to finish them off, which makes a big difference on vehicles that travel Ponchatoula's clay back roads regularly.

How often should I detail my car in Ponchatoula?
Given Ponchatoula's high humidity, abundant pine pollen, clay-heavy rural roads, and intense summer sun, we recommend a full detail every three to four months and a maintenance detail every four to six weeks in between. The combination of moisture and heat in Tangipahoa Parish accelerates paint oxidation, mildew growth, and interior wear faster than in drier climates, so staying on a regular schedule pays off significantly over time.
